Sons of Anarchy is a U.S. TV series (2008 – 2014) created by Kurt Sutter.

The series consists of 7 seasons with 13 episodes each, each with an average duration of about 50 minutes, and is available on Netflix. The SAMCRO (Sons of Anarchy Motorcycle Club, Redwood Original) is a motorcycle club spread along the western coast (California).

The main headquarters is located in Charming,

S.O.A tells the epic of this club led by Clay Morrow (Ron Perlman, a well-established and aging actor known to many for embodying the fearsome Hellboy by Guillermo Del Toro).

Clay is a ruthless gangster, and the evil Gemma Teller (Katey Sagal, in real life, the wife of Kurt Sutter) is no less; indeed.

Gemma is the mother of one of the club's members, the absolute protagonist, Jax Teller (Charlie Hunnam, a British actor born in 1980). The father, John Teller and Gemma’s first husband, is the club's founder and is already dead at the beginning of the series…

The SAMCRO runs a workshop, repairing motorcycles and cars, but it's just a front. In reality, they mainly deal with arms trafficking, offer protection, and practically control and rule the town of Charming more or less undisturbed.

Clashes between rival gangs: The Mayans (Mexicans, the brown), the Niners (African-Americans, the black), the Chinese, the Aryan Brotherhood …not to mention the I.R.A. (the Irish, the weapons suppliers). And then the Colombian cartel, the ATF, the CIA…

Twists, betrayals, double games. A thick and unforgettable gallery of characters, including the infamous Danny Trejo (he was indeed a criminal and drug addict in real life, in his youth he entered and exited prison several times).

The bond of brotherhood that unites them, the SAMCRO code is indissoluble, inseparable. The value attributed to family, both the biological one and the SAMCRO family, is absolute. Breaking such bonds is considered high treason, the penalty is death.

If I had to describe, to outline the characters of SOA, or worse, if I just tried to recount what happens, I would have to pen a small book, which does not seem appropriate. Just know that you never relax; as soon as one problem is solved, another much worse one erupts…

The series starts quietly but gradually enriches itself with characters and situations with a devastating impact. It is a constant crescendo, a huge tragedy that takes on Shakespearean connotations, almost unbearable.
